# Specifies the boot device. This is where Lilo installs its boot
# block. It can be either a partition, or the raw device, in which
# case it installs in the MBR, and will overwrite the current MBR.
#
boot=/dev/hda

# You can set a password here, and uncomment the `restricted' lines
# in the image definitions below to make it so that a password must
# be typed to boot anything but a default configuration. If a
# command line is given, other than one specified by an `append'
# statement in `lilo.conf', the password will be required, but a
# standard default boot will not require one.
#
# This will, for instance, prevent anyone with access to the
# console from booting with something like `Linux init=/bin/sh',
# and thus becoming `root' without proper authorization.
#
# Note that if you really need this type of security, you will
# likely also want to use `install-mbr' to reconfigure the MBR
# program, as well as set up your BIOS to disallow booting from
# removable disk or CD-ROM, then put a password on getting into the
# BIOS configuration as well. Please RTFM `install-mbr(8)'.
#
# password=tatercounter2000
# Specifies the number of deciseconds (0.1 seconds) LILO should
# wait before booting the first image.
#
delay=20
